GitHub, yazılımcılar için dijital bir vitrin, kariyerin en önemli parçalarından biridir. İş görüşmelerinde, freelance iş başvurularında ve online portföylerde ilk bakılan yer GitHub’dır. Bu yüzden düzenli, profesyonel ve etkileyici bir GitHub profili kariyerine büyük katkı sağlar.
Bu rehberde GitHub portföyünü adım adım nasıl geliştirebileceğini anlatıcam iyi okumalar.
Profesyonel Bir Profil README’si Hazırla
GitHub profilinde görünen en önemli alan, README.md dosyasıdır.
README’de olması gerekenler:
-
Kısa bio: Kim olduğunu ve ne yaptığını anlat
-
Teknolojiler: Logo veya liste halinde bildiğin diller
-
GitHub istatistik kartları
-
Proje referansları
-
Sertifikalar veya başarılar
-
Sosyal medya linkleri (LinkedIn, portfolio site)
Not: Görsel ikonlar ve modern tasarımlar çok ilgi çeker.
Düzenli Bir Repo Yapısı Oluştur
Düzensiz bir GitHub, “Bu kişi dağınık çalışıyor” izlenimi verir.
Başarılı repo düzeni:
✔ Açıklayıcı klasör isimleri
✔ README dosyası
✔ Projeyi nasıl çalıştıracağını anlatan dokümantasyon
✔ Gereksiz dosyaların .gitignore ile temizlenmesi
✔ Versiyon numaraları, commit mesajı düzeni
Etkileyici Projeler Ekleyin (Sadece Ödev Değil!)
GitHub portföyü kaliteli projeler ile öne çıkar.
Ekleyebileceğin örnek projeler:
-
Blog sitesi (React, Next.js, Django)
-
Mobil uygulama (Flutter/React Native)
-
Basit bir API (Node.js, Go, Python Flask)
-
Veri analizi projeleri
-
Yapay zekâ modelleri
-
Oyun projeleri (Unity, Godot)
Kalite > sayısal çokluk.
README Dosyalarını Profesyonel Yaz
Her projede README şart!
İçermesi gerekenler:
-
Projenin amacı
-
Kullanılan teknolojiler
-
Kurulum adımları
-
Ekran görüntüleri
-
API dökümanı (varsa)
GitHub’ın Markdown formatı ile zengin içerik ekleyebilirsin.
Düzenli Commit At (Aktif Görün)
GitHub, geliştiricilerin aktifliğini gösteren bir platformdur.
İyi commit alışkanlıkları:
-
Anlamlı commit mesajları
-
Tek seferde çok büyük commit yapmamak
-
Sorunları issue section’da belirtmek
Açık Kaynak Projelere Katkı Sağla
Bu, GitHub profilini uçurur.
Neler yapabilirsin?
-
Issue açmak
-
Hata düzeltmek
-
Dokümantasyonu geliştirmek
-
Kütüphanelere PR göndermek
Firmalar açık kaynak katkısına çok değer verir.
GitHub Pages ile Portföy Sitesi Kur
GitHub, ücretsiz olarak web sitesi yayınlamana izin verir.
Yapabileceklerin:
-
Kişisel portföy
-
Blog
-
Proje tanıtım sayfaları
Tamamen ücretsiz ve SEO dostudur.
Etkileyici Proje Kartları Kullan
Profilinde kullandığın GitHub widget’ları portföyü profesyonel gösterir:
-
GitHub Stats Card
-
Streak Card
-
Top Languages Card
-
Repo pin’leme
Görsel olarak kaliteli duran profiller daha çok dikkat çeker.
Kod Kalitesine Özen Göster
GitHub sadece görünüm değil, kalite göstergesidir.
Dikkat edilmesi gerekenler:
-
Temiz kod
-
Açıklayıcı fonksiyon isimleri
-
Testler
-
Kod düzeni: Prettier, ESLint gibi araçlar
Özel Repo Oluşturma Stratejisi
Bazı projeleri public yap, bazılarını private tut.
Public olması mantıklı olan projeler:
-
Portföy projeleri
-
Öğrenme projeleri
-
Open-source katkılar
Private olması mantıklı olanlar:
-
Deneysel ve karışık projeler
-
Yarı bitmiş işlevsiz kodlar
Bir Cevap Yaz
E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ir.
12 Yorum
Beğendim içeriği site hızı düzeltilmiş gibi duruyor ben mi öyle farkettim
Evet hocam gece çalışma vardı galiba sitede 10dklik uyari veriyordu düzeltilmis hizli suan
Site çalışanlarını e postaya boğduk 😀 düzeltilmiş site çok hızlı şuan
Siteyi düzelten ekip sövmüştür bu arada gerçekten jxshshhshssnxnsjs
Evet düzeltilmis cok hizli yapmislar sayfa cok aciliyor
Editör çok iyisin editörrr instani ver
Lan editörünü sal artık bütün yorumlara yaziyon xhshhahshsgsgddgd
Ne zaman içerik baksam yorumlarda bu kız
🔥🔥🔥
Github için detaylı olmuş keşfet
Baya iyi yazılmış nicee
Bir yazilimci kiz olarak cok iyi anladım gerçekten cok teşekkür ederim editörr